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Pasta: I like using pasta shells because their shape holds the creamy sauce nicely. However, you can use any small pasta like penne, fusilli, or rotini. Just cook according to the package instructions!

Olive Oil: Extra virgin olive oil adds a lovely flavor. If you’re out, you can substitute with canola oil or avocado oil, but the taste won’t be quite the same.

Garlic: Fresh garlic adds a great aroma and flavor. If you have garlic powder, use about 1/4 teaspoon instead, but fresh is always best in this dish!

Cherry Tomatoes: Fresh cherry tomatoes are sweet and burst with flavor, but you can use canned diced tomatoes if that’s what you have on hand. Just be sure to drain them a bit.

Heavy Cream: This gives a rich texture. For a lighter option, you could try half-and-half or even coconut milk, but this will change the flavor a bit.

Basil: Fresh basil is a must here for that vibrant flavor! If fresh isn’t available, you can use 1 teaspoon of dried basil, but the taste will be different.

How do I make sure my sauce has the perfect texture?

Getting the sauce just right is super important for this dish. Here’s how to do it:

  • Start by adding the heavy cream slowly to the skillet after the garlic and tomatoes are cooked. Stir gently to avoid splattering.
  • Once the cream is added, let it warm up but don’t boil it. A gentle heat helps to thicken the sauce without curdling.
  • Add cheese gradually. This helps it melt smoothly into the cream, creating a velvety sauce.
  • If your sauce looks too thick, don’t panic! Just add a little of the reserved pasta water, mixing until you find that perfect balance.

These steps ensure you’ll have a lovely creamy sauce that clings to each piece of pasta beautifully!

Easy Creamy Basil Tomato Pasta

Ingredients You’ll Need:

  • 8 ounces pasta shells (or your favorite small pasta)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, chopped (or 1 large tomato, diced)
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ese, plus more for serving
  • 1/2 cup fresh basil leaves, chopped or torn
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Optional: pinch of red pepper flakes for heat

How Much Time Will You Need?

This recipe is quick and easy! Expect about 10 minutes for prep and 15 minutes for cooking, so you’ll be enjoying your creamy basil tomato pasta in just about 25 minutes!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Cook the Pasta:

Start by bringing a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ta shells and cook according to the package instructions until they are al dente. Once cooked, drain the pasta while saving about 1/2 cup of pasta cooking water for later use.

2. Sauté the Garlic:

While the pasta cooks, grab a large skillet and he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té it for about 1 minute. You want it fragrant but not brown, so keep an eye on it!

3. Add the Tomatoes:

Now, add the chopped tomatoes to the skillet. Cook them for around 3-4 minutes, until they start to soften. The colors will brighten, and you’ll start to smell those delicious tomato flavors!

4. Make the Creamy Sauce:

Reduce the heat to medium-low, then pour in the heavy cream. Stir gently to combine everything. Next, sprinkle the grated Parmesan cheese into the skillet. Keep stirring so that the cheese melts and the sauce thickens slightly. Trust me, this looks and smells amazing!

5. Combine with Pasta:

Toss the cooked pasta shells into the skillet with the creamy tomato sauce. Stir gently to coat the pasta evenly. If the sauce seems too thick, add a little of the reserved pasta water a tablespoon at a time. Adjust until you reach the consistency you like!

6. Add Fresh Basil:

Now it’s time to stir in the fresh basil leaves! Nice and aromatic, they add that burst of flavor we love. Reserve a few leaves for garnishing later.

7. Season and Serve:

Finally, add sal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ste. If you like a bit of heat, sprinkle in some red pepper flakes too! Give it a good stir, and you’re ready to eat.

8. Enjoy Your Dish:

Remove the skillet from heat and serve your creamy basil tomato pasta immediately. Don’t forget to top with extra Parmesan cheese and a few fresh basil leaves for that perfect finishing touch!

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I Use Whole Wheat or Gluten-Free Pasta?

Absolutely! Whole wheat or gluten-free pasta will work perfectly in this recipe. Just be sure to adjust the cooking time according to the package instructions, as they can vary from regular pasta.

How Long Can Leftovers Be Stored?

You can store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, warm gently on the stovetop over low heat, adding a splash of cream or water if needed to loosen the sauce.

What Can I Substitute for Heavy Cream?

If you’re looking for a lighter option, you can use half-and-half or a plant-based milk like almond or coconut milk. Just note that the flavor may change slightly, and you might need to add a bit of flour to thicken the sauce.

Can I Add Other Vegetables or Protein?

Definitely! Feel free to add cooked vegetables like spinach, bell peppers, or mushrooms for extra nutrition. If you want to add protein, grilled chicken or shrimp would pair nicely with this pasta dish. Just adjust the cooking time accordingly!
